Title: Project/Program Manager (Non-IT) 2 – Change Management Specialist
Location: Mossville, IL (Fully Onsite)
Duration: 12 months
Pay Rate: $37/hour (W2) or $42/hour (C2C)

Job Description:
The Change Management Specialist will implement organizational change initiatives that enable the organization to achieve greater performance. This role involves guiding business units across the enterprise through change processes, influencing adoption, and ensuring successful transformation outcomes.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ct needs analysis and impact assessments to determine the most effective approach for implementing change.
  • Provide consultation and recommendations to stakeholders for managing organizational change.
  • Influence and lead individuals toward adoption of change initiatives to achieve business results.
  • Create and execute change plans, coordinate meetings, drive action items, and analyze outcomes.
  • Ensure consistent and timely execution of change implementation plans.

Qualifications (Required):

  • Associate degree required; Bachelor’s preferred.
  • 5+ years of experience in Organizational Change Management.
  • Knowledge of OCM principles.
  • Proficiency with MS Word, PowerPoint, and Excel.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age time effectively
  • Strong execution skills and ability to lead without authority.

Qualifications (Desired):

  • OCM certification.
  • Project management experience.
  • Previous Caterpillar experience.

Disqualifiers:

  • No experience as an Organizational Change Management professional.
  • Not willing to be onsite five days per week.

Typical Day & Interaction with Team:

  • Develop and execute change management plans.
  • Coordinate meetings, follow up on action items, and think analytically.
  • Work with a mentor during onboarding until ready to lead projects independently.
  • Engage with stakeholders across the organization to drive adoption of change initiatives.
